Job Profile
Reporting to the Manager Application Support and Analysis, this role significantly contributes to the efficient and effective development, operation and support of the business critical and highly visible (public) Web and Gaming systems at Lotterywest. The role requires expertise across a range of Gaming and Web applications including BOS, LOTOS, Horizon, Player Pulse, CANVAS, Online sales channel and the associated end point device software(eg Photon, Genion, Gablet).
The role has the following key areas of focus:
- Gaming/Web Systems Enhancements
- Management throughout the full lifecycle of enhancements
- Gaming/Web Systems Support
- Technical support, analysis and troubleshooting of system issues
- Stakeholder Relationships
– Builds and maintains strong business relationships in the provision of Gaming/Web systems improvement and support
We're looking for someone with;
- Experience in solving technical issues in Gaming or Web applications
- Knowledge of methodologies for effective systems development, testing, implementation, operation and support
- Experience in testing activities for projects or maintenance of complex IT environments, including test development, execution, monitoring & reporting
- Good attention to detail with the ability to track and manage testing processes and defects
- High level interpersonal and communication skills and the ability to work collaboratively across teams and with relevant stakeholders
